Marubeni Energy Corporation, a subsidiary of the Marubeni Group, is a prominent player in the energy sector, headquartered in Japan. Established in 2011, the company has rapidly expanded its operations across Asia, North America, and Europe, focusing on renewable energy, power generation, and energy trading. Specialising in solar, wind, and biomass energy, Marubeni Energy distinguishes itself through innovative solutions and a commitment to sustainability. The company has achieved significant milestones, including the development of large-scale renewable projects that contribute to global energy transition efforts. With a strong market position, Marubeni Energy is recognised for its expertise in energy management and its dedication to reducing carbon footprints, making it a key contributor to the evolving energy landscape.
